Abstract

Systems and methods for reducing multicast IP packet bandwidth in a local area network carrying Internet protocol television (IPTV) traffic are disclosed. One embodiment of a system comprises: a layer-2 switch; a slave digital home communication terminal (DHCT); and a master DHCT. The layer-2 switch has a control channel and a plurality of data ports. The slave DHCT is coupled to a first data port of the plurality. The master DHCT is coupled to the layer-2 switch control channel. The master DHCT comprises logic for requesting the layer-2 switch, over the control channel, operate in a first configuration. In the first configuration, the layer-2 switch associates a layer-2 multicast address with the first data port, examines layer-2 multicast packets, and forwards the examined layer-2 multicast packets on the first data port only if the layer-2 destination address is the first layer-2 multicast address.

Claims (44)

1. A digital home communication terminal (DHCT) for reducing multicast IP packet bandwidth in a local area network carrying Internet protocol television (IPTV) traffic, the DHCT comprising:

logic for determining an IP multicast address and a port identifier, each associated with a slave DHCT;

logic for transmitting a layer-2 multicast address derived from the IP multicast address and the port identifier to the switch as a request for the switch to operate in a first multicast configuration,

the layer-2 switch operating in the first multicast configuration to associate the first layer-2 multicast address with the data port, examine layer-2 packets having a layer-2 multicast destination address, and forward the examined layer-2 multicast packets on the data port, wherein the forwarding occurs only if the layer-2 destination address is the first layer-2 multicast address.
